As for my Skype issue, I discovered that Skype automatically mutes the mic when you hit 'call.' If you open up the control panel's audio settings, and uncheck the microphone's 'mute' box, you can hear your voice perfectly on a call.
I'm looking for a way to make Skype not automatically mute the mic..but until I do, unchecking the 'mute' box is an acceptable workaround.
